This video tutorial on wave interference explores how waves interact with objects and each other. It covers concepts like reflection, constructive and destructive interference, and standing waves. Using examples like a slinky and simulations, the video demonstrates how waves can be reflected, inverted, and interfere constructively or destructively. The tutorial also explains the law of superposition and how standing waves are formed, providing practical examples and simulations to illustrate these phenomena.
